Preview
Valencia comes into this after a 4-1 away loss to Real Betis on Wednesday, which left them winless in the league since September.
Iglesias scored two goals while Pezzella and Juanmi also found the back of the net for the hosts while Paulista’s goal proved to be a mere consolation effort for Valencia.
This kept them in 11th spot with 13 points with 2 losses and 3 draws in their last 5 matches.
On the other hand, Villarreal played out a thrilling 3-3 draw in their previous match against Cadiz.
Torres, Dia and a late Danjuma effort ensured the Yellow Submarine salvaged a point after Lozano scored a hat-trick for Cadiz.
Villarreal is in 13th place with 12 points from 10 matches and haven’t won a league match since their win against Real Betis in early October.
Both sides last met in pre-season friendly match in July, where Valencia won 3-2.
